/* CSS Document */
body{
font-family: Helvetica, Arial;
font-weight: normal;
font-size: 12px;
}

p{
padding: 0px 0px 0px 0px;
margin: 10px 20px 20px 20px;
line-height: 150%; 
}
p img{
float: left;
margin: 0px 10px 10px 0px;

}

h1.h1_startseite{
font-family: Helvetica, Arial;
font-weight: bold;
font-size: 18px;
padding: 0px 0px 0px 0px;
margin: 25px 0px 0px 0px;
}

h1{
font-family: Helvetica, Arial;
font-weight: bold;
font-size: 18px;
padding: 0px 0px 0px 0px;
margin: 0px 0px 0px 0px;
}

h2{
font-family: Helvetica, Arial;
font-weight: bold;
font-size: 14px;
color: #227B20;
padding: 0px 0px 0px 0px;
margin: 10px 0px 0px 5px;
}

h2.h2_startseite{
font-family: Helvetica, Arial;
font-weight: normal;
font-size: 12px;
color: #000;
line-height: 150%; 
padding: 0px 50px 0px 0px;
margin: 15px 0px 0px 0px;
}

h2.h2_headline{
font-family: Helvetica, Arial;
font-weight: bold;
font-size: 14px;
color: #227B20;
padding: 0px 0px 0px 0px;
margin: 10px 0px 0px 5px;
}

h2.h2_content_headline{
font-family: Helvetica, Arial;
font-weight: bold;
font-size: 16px;
color: #000;
padding: 0px 0px 0px 0px;
margin: 15px 0px -8px 5px;
}

h3{
font-family: Helvetica, Arial;
font-weight: normal;
font-size: 12px;
padding: 0px 0px 0px 0px;
margin: 10px 0px 0px 5px;
}

form{
padding: 0px ;
margin: 0px 20px 0px 20px;
}

*html form{
padding: 0px;
margin: 0px;
}

a{
font-family: Helvetica, Arial;
font-weight: normal;
font-size: 12px;
color: #748E51;
}
a.hauptmenu{
font-family: Helvetica, Arial;
font-weight: bold;
font-size: 12px;
color: #FFF;
text-decoration: none;
}
a.hauptmenu:hover{
color: #B6D699;
}
a.hauptmenu_aktiv{
font-family: Helvetica, Arial;
font-weight: bold;
font-size: 12px;
color: #B6D699;
text-decoration: underline;
}

a.submenu{
font-family: Helvetica, Arial;
font-weight: normal;
font-size: 12px;
color: #FFF;
text-decoration: none;
}

a.content{
font-family: Helvetica, Arial;
font-weight: normal;
font-size: 12px;
color: #829E69;
text-decoration: none;
}

#ul_menu{
padding:0px 0px 0px 30px;
margin:0px;
list-style-type: square;
font-family: Helvetica, Arial;
font-weight: normal;
font-size: 12px;
font-variant:small-caps;
color: #FFF;
}
#ul_menu li{
padding: 3px;
}

#ul_submenu{
padding:0px 0px 0px 10px;
margin:0px;
list-style-type: none;
font-family: Helvetica, Arial;
font-weight: normal;
font-size: 12px;
color: #FFF;
}
#ul_submenu li{
padding: 3px;
}

#ul_liste_content{
padding: 0px 0px 0px 35px;
margin: -15px 0px 20px 0px;
list-style-type: square;
font-family: Helvetica, Arial;
font-weight: normal;
font-size: 12px;
}
#font_neu{
font-style:italic;
font-weight: bold;
text-decoration: underline;
}

